Transaction e9738351769cdef131e2c4e445069fa60c51a556da6622343a537d158c658569
1 Input
1 Output
-
e9738351769cdef131e2c4e445069fa60c51a556da6622343a537d158c658569:0
- value
- 16680
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e2676175284d0927cc8ebfce9660fce4a2fded9f84aa9a2fdf9a066aa8a0f00f
- address
- ltc1pufnkzafgf5yj0nywhl8fvc8uuj30mmvlsj4f5t7lngrx429q7q8ss5zghl